TES Electives

At TES, specials (lower school) and electives (upper school) are vibrant courses that are considered just as important as core classes. Specials and electives courses at TES allow students to explore a range of arts, sciences, language, and other activities, broadening their exposure and helping them develop new and creative skills. These courses also help students develop social, practical, and behavioral skills, and can boost their confidence at the same time. 

Students at TES attend specials/electives each day.  In the Lower School, students participate in general core specials; as students move to the Upper School, electives are varied and students have some choice in their selections. 


Lower School Electives K-4
 
Lower School students rotate through PE, Music, Art and STEM. Specials occur each day of school.
 
Upper School Electives
 
5th Grade: Students rotate through PE, Music, Art, Typing
 
6th Grade: Students choose between Band or Art Deep Dive, and rotate through both STEM and PE.
 
7th-8th grade: All students participate in general PE, and then elect Deep Dives of either Band, Adulting, or Art and Explores of Adulting/Lifeskills, Art, PE, STEM, or Robotics.
